While people are being pushed towards colleges and universities, apprentices are earning a living without accumulating massive amounts of student debt.

The Western Pennsylvania Electrical JATC provides a place for apprentices to learn course material as they advance through the apprenticeship program with electrical training centers located in Pittsburgh and Clearfield.

Apprentices go to work during the day, earning a livable wage and benefits, and attend night classes a few times a week. This earn while you learn model has been proven to work for decades. This method keeps apprentices motivated and leaving work every day with a sense of worth.

The instructors at the Western Pennsylvania Electrical JATC are experienced journeymen who have spent years in the field and are qualified to educate the next generation of Local 5 electrical workers.

Additionally, the Western Pennsylvania Electrical JATC is partnered with the Community College of Allegheny County (CCAC). Apprentices can earn credit towards an associate’s degree through the partnership the Western Pennsylvania JATC has with the college. While apprentices are learning their trade, they also complete coursework through CCAC.
